Complex Operation Vulnerabilities

Operation

Complex Operation Vulnerabilities, within c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ives, represent systemic weaknesses arising from the intricate sequencing and interaction of multiple processes. These vulnerabilities are not isolated coding errors but rather emerge from the orchestration of various components, such as order routing, risk management systems, and smart contract execution. Exploitation often involves manipulating the operational flow to bypass intended safeguards or trigger unintended consequences, demanding a holistic understanding of the entire trading lifecycle. Mitigation requires rigorous process mapping, automated testing across diverse scenarios, and continuous monitoring for anomalous behavior.
